#include "dynstr.h"
|
|
#include <stdio.h>
|
|
#include <string.h>
|
|
#include <stdlib.h>
|
|
#include <stdarg.h>
|
|
#include <stddef.h>
|
|
|
|
#if __STDC_VERSION__ < 199901L
|
|
#error C99 support is mandatory for dynstr
|
|
#endif /* __STDC_VERSION < 199901L */
|
|
|
|
void dynstr_init(struct dynstr *const d)
|
|
{
|
|
memset(d, 0, sizeof *d);
|
|
}
|
|
|
|
enum dynstr_err dynstr_vappend(struct dynstr *const d, const char *const format, va_list ap)
|
|
{
|
|
enum dynstr_err err = DYNSTR_OK;
|
|
va_list apc;
|
|
|
|
va_copy(apc, ap);
|
|
|
|
{
|
|
const size_t src_len = vsnprintf(NULL, 0, format, ap);
|
|
const size_t new_len = d->len + src_len + 1;
|
|
|
|
d->str = realloc(d->str, new_len * sizeof *d->str);
|
|
|
|
if (d->str)
|
|
{
|
|
vsprintf(d->str + d->len, format, apc);
|
|
d->len += src_len;
|
|
}
|
|
else
|
|
{
|
|
err = DYNSTR_ERR_ALLOC;
|
|
}
|
|
}
|
|
|
|
va_end(apc);
|
|
return err;
|
|
}
|
|
|
|
enum dynstr_err dynstr_append(struct dynstr *const d, const char *const format, ...)
|
|
{
|
|
va_list ap;
|
|
enum dynstr_err err;
|
|
|
|
va_start(ap, format);
|
|
err = dynstr_vappend(d, format, ap);
|
|
va_end(ap);
|
|
return err;
|
|
}
|
|
|
|
enum dynstr_err dynstr_vprepend(struct dynstr *const d, const char *const format, va_list ap)
|
|
{
|
|
enum dynstr_err err = DYNSTR_OK;
|
|
va_list apc;
|
|
|
|
va_copy(apc, ap);
|
|
|
|
{
|
|
const size_t src_len = vsnprintf(NULL, 0, format, ap);
|
|
const size_t new_len = d->len + src_len + 1;
|
|
|
|
d->str = realloc(d->str, new_len * sizeof *d->str);
|
|
|
|
if (d->str && d->len)
|
|
{
|
|
/* Keep byte that will be removed by later call to vsprintf. */
|
|
const char c = *d->str;
|
|
|
|
for (size_t i = new_len - 1, j = d->len; j <= d->len; i--, j--)
|
|
{
|
|
d->str[i] = d->str[j];
|
|
}
|
|
|
|
vsprintf(d->str, format, apc);
|
|
d->str[src_len] = c;
|
|
}
|
|
else if (!d->len)
|
|
{
|
|
vsprintf(d->str + d->len, format, apc);
|
|
}
|
|
else
|
|
{
|
|
err = DYNSTR_ERR_ALLOC;
|
|
}
|
|
|
|
d->len += src_len;
|
|
}
|
|
|
|
va_end(apc);
|
|
return err;
|
|
}
|
|
|
|
enum dynstr_err dynstr_prepend(struct dynstr *const d, const char *const format, ...)
|
|
{
|
|
va_list ap;
|
|
enum dynstr_err err;
|
|
|
|
va_start(ap, format);
|
|
err = dynstr_vprepend(d, format, ap);
|
|
return err;
|
|
}
|
|
|
|
enum dynstr_err dynstr_dup(struct dynstr *const dst, const struct dynstr *const src)
|
|
{
|
|
if (!dst->str && !dst->len)
|
|
{
|
|
if (src->len && src->str)
|
|
{
|
|
const size_t sz = (src->len + 1) * sizeof *dst->str;
|
|
dst->str = realloc(dst->str, sz);
|
|
|
|
if (dst->str)
|
|
{
|
|
memcpy(dst->str, src->str, sz);
|
|
dst->len = src->len;
|
|
}
|
|
else
|
|
{
|
|
return DYNSTR_ERR_ALLOC;
|
|
}
|
|
}
|
|
else
|
|
{
|
|
return DYNSTR_ERR_SRC;
|
|
}
|
|
}
|
|
else
|
|
{
|
|
return DYNSTR_ERR_INIT;
|
|
}
|
|
|
|
return DYNSTR_OK;
|
|
}
|
|
|
|
void dynstr_free(struct dynstr *const d)
|
|
{
|
|
if (d->str)
|
|
{
|
|
free(d->str);
|
|
dynstr_init(d);
|
|
}
|
|
}
